PhD Scholarship in Experimental Ecophysiology and Biology of Lumpsucker (DTU Aqua)
Blue-jobs Kgs. Lyngby, Denmark
Job title PhD Scholarship in Experimental Ecophysiology and Biology of Lumpsucker. Company DTU Aqua - National Institute of Aquatic Resources, Technical University of Denmark. Description of the job DTU Aqua is offering a fully funded 3-year PhD position within the newly established project NOW-LUMP, funded by Seabreak. The project aims to build fundamental knowledge on the biology and environmental tolerance of the lumpsucker (Cyclopterus lumpus) — a culturally and ecologically important species that has undergone a severe population decline in Scandinavian waters. The successful candidate will join a supportive and dynamic research environment at DTU Aqua. The PhD will be based in the Section for Marine Living Resources as part of the Fish Biology research group. The PhD will be supervised by Senior Researcher Jane W. PhD Studentship in Atlantic Salmon Ecology and Climate Change Impacts (INRS)
€27,000 yearly
Blue-jobs Quebec, Canada
Job title PhD Studentship in Cumulative Impacts of Environmental Changes on Atlantic Salmon Ecology, Population Trends and Survival. Company Institut national de la recherche scientifique (INRS). Description of the job The Institut national de la recherche scientifique (INRS) is seeking a curious and passionate PhD student to study the cumulative impacts of environmental changes on Atlantic salmon ecology, population trends, and survival. This work will contribute directly to protecting and preserving wild salmon populations in a changing climate. Natural and anthropogenic threats to freshwater habitat lead to challenges for Atlantic Salmon survival resulting in population declines. Salmon rivers are subject to a variety of cumulative habitat impacts due to development and environmental changes in their freshwater watersheds.
